Using the Kaleidoscope Painting mode
Corel Painter lets you to transform basic brushstrokes into a colorful and symmetrical kaleidoscope image.
When you paint a brushstroke in one kaleidoscope segment, multiple reflections of the brushstroke appear
in the other segments. You can apply between 3 to 12 mirror planes to a kaleidoscope. You can also rotate
or reposition the mirror planes to expose different colors and patterns.
The green lines that display in the document window delineate the symmetrical planes.
To create a kaleidoscope painting
1
In the toolbox, click the Kaleidoscope Painting tool .
2 In the Segment Number box on the property bar, type the number of planes that you want to display.
3 Click the Brush Selector on the Brush Selector bar.
4 In the Brush library panel, click a brush category, and click a brush variant.
5 Apply brushstrokes in any of the kaleidoscope segments.
If you want to achieve a spiralling effect, apply brushstrokes across multiple segments.
To Do the following
Hide the kaleidoscope planes while painting
Click the Toggle Planes button on the
property bar.
